When dividing a number by 5 that's not a multiple of 5, you'll need to identify the quotient and remainder. For example, if you want to divide 17 by 5, you would identify that 3 groups of 5 can be made, with a remainder of 2. The quotient would be 3, indicating that 3 groups of 5 can be made from the given number.
